I believe this to be true. I cannot imagine trying to take the certification exam in my second or third year as a WMB developer, as I had not yet been exposed to enough use cases to make correct decisions. People who coached and mentored me help me learn so much more than I could have ever learned through the labs.

The eleven day training course provides a superb foundation for the coaching and mentoring to follow.

I believe that the exam is designed so that training is not sufficient.

I also believe that anyone attempting to cheat on this exam is doing themselves a disservice - because the more people cheat on this exam, the less value the certification itself has in the market place.

If you can't pass the practice test, go back and study more. Don't try to steal answers.
